Amelioration Effects of Vitamin E, Melatonin, L-carnitine, and Atorvastatin, on Destructive Effects of Busulfan in the Testes of Male Rats: A Gene Expression Evaluation

According to toxicity of various types of cancer treatments on different kind of cells with high division activities such as germ cells, antioxidants mayprotect these cells in testes against the toxic effects of the chemotherapeutic drugs. For this purpose, 24 h after busulfan treatment, 30 adult malewistar-rats were divided to six groups. Intra-peritoneally administrations of normal saline in control group and DMSO (as a busulfan solvent) in DMSOgroup were performed daily for 6 weeks beside the treatment contain vitamin E (Vit-E group), L-carnitine and melatonin (LM group), atorvastatin andmelatonin (AM group), atorvastatin, L-carnitine, and melatonin (ALM group). After decapitation and removal of the testes, molecular evaluations wereperformed by the relative abundance measurement of DAZL, Bcl2, and Casp3 transcripts.
